> So lets try to find what is written in C/C++ by some different way. Is
> that true, that every package in C/C++ compiled using gcc depends on
> glibc? Then we can use this query to get the number of packages:
>
> $ repoquery --source --whatrequires 'libc.so.6(GLIBC_2.4)(64bit)' | sort
> | uniq | wc -l
> 2834

Well, ... any explanation why this figure differs significantly from 
this brute force estimate [1]:
# rpm -q --qf "%{SOURCERPM}\n" \
  -p rawhide/i386/os/Packages/*/*.i686.rpm 2>/dev/null | sort -u | wc -l
7706

Ralf

[1] Counting the unique src.rpms of all binary rpms in a local rawhide 
mirror.
